The Strategic Anchor

Every major element of Saudi Arabia’s AI buildout traces back, ultimately, to a single decision-maker: Mohammed bin Salman, Crown Prince and Prime Minister of the Kingdom of Saudi Arabia. SDAIA was established by royal order in 2019. PIF’s investment committee is chaired by MBS. Humain was launched under his personal patronage at a summit he convened with a foreign head of state. Vision 2030 is his program. The $77 billion AI commitment is, at its root, his bet on a technology-enabled future for the Saudi state.

This concentration of decision authority is both the source of Saudi Arabia’s AI buildout’s extraordinary pace and its most significant structural risk. When a single individual can commit sovereign wealth fund capital at the scale of national GDP, establish new government authorities within months of deciding they are needed, and direct diplomatic relationships in service of a technology vision, the implementation latency that would paralyze any consensus-based governance system simply does not apply. MBS decided that Saudi Arabia would become a global AI power; SDAIA was established; Humain was launched at scale; the NVIDIA deal was embedded in a heads-of-state summit. The decision-to-action timeline is compressed to a degree that democratic governments and conventional corporate boards can only observe with a mixture of admiration and concern.

The risk is the precise mirror of that speed: if MBS’s priorities shift, if his attention moves to a different strategic domain, if his position is destabilized, or if he misjudges the long-term economics of the AI infrastructure bet, the institutional momentum behind the buildout could decelerate with equally extraordinary speed. Saudi Arabia’s AI infrastructure depends on sustained political will emanating from a single source. That is not an inherently fragile arrangement in the near term — MBS’s control of the Saudi state apparatus is as consolidated as it has been since his father’s 2015 accession — but it is a structural governance feature that any serious long-term analysis must incorporate.

Ascending to Power: The Technology Vision Takes Shape

MBS’s ascent to dominance of the Saudi state unfolded over the period from 2015 to 2017. His appointment as Defense Minister in 2015, then as Deputy Crown Prince and head of PIF in 2016, and finally as Crown Prince in 2017 — supplanting his cousin Mohammed bin Nayef — established his position as the unquestioned decision-maker for Saudi Arabia’s future direction.

The Vision 2030 announcement in April 2016 was his first major public policy statement of the Deputy Crown Prince era, and its scope was deliberately ambitious enough to signal that MBS was not interested in incremental policy change. The vision was explicitly structured around a theory of economic transformation: use sovereign capital to build non-oil industries while the oil revenues that fund the investment remain sufficient to make the investment. This theory is economically coherent; the question is whether the implementation timeline is achievable.

The SDAIA establishment in 2019 was the first major AI-specific institutional move, and MBS’s decision to chair it personally rather than delegating to a minister was the clearest signal of his personal investment in the AI agenda. In the Saudi governance context, an authority chaired by the Crown Prince is categorically different from a ministerial-level body: it has access to the attention, resources, budget flexibility, and political backing that no ministry can command. When SDAIA issues guidelines or standards, they carry the implicit backing of the Crown Prince’s office in a way that ministerial regulations do not.

By 2025, the AI strategy had evolved from policy and governance (SDAIA, NSDAI) to capital commitment at unprecedented scale (PIF, Humain, the $77 billion framework). This evolution reflects MBS’s characteristic approach to large-scale change: establish the governance architecture and institutional capacity first, then deploy capital to implement at speed. The pattern is visible across Vision 2030 sectors — the entertainment sector was legally enabled before capital was deployed; the tourism sector’s regulatory framework preceded the major resort investments; SDAIA’s data governance framework preceded the Allam launch. This sequencing is disciplined strategic execution, not opportunistic announcement-making.

The Trump-MBS Summit: May 13, 2025

The Trump-MBS summit of May 13, 2025 is the defining external event of the Saudi AI buildout’s launch phase, and it deserves careful analysis beyond the obvious. Its significance operates simultaneously at the commercial, diplomatic, and geopolitical levels.

At the commercial level, the summit produced the diplomatic framework that enabled the Humain-NVIDIA deal. The US AI Diffusion framework’s Tier-2 licensing requirements meant that Blackwell GPU exports to Saudi Arabia required US government facilitation. A purchase order alone would not have been sufficient; BIS licensing required a political-level determination that Saudi Arabia was a sufficiently trusted partner. The heads-of-state format converted that determination into a diplomatic deliverable that both governments had strong incentives to consummate quickly.

At the diplomatic level, the summit produced the trillion-dollar pledge framework — an aggregate commitment covering US-Saudi economic cooperation across energy, technology, defense, and investment. The scale of the framework was calibrated to demonstrate that the US-Saudi relationship was being reset comprehensively, addressing the strains that had accumulated over the preceding years following the 2018 Khashoggi murder and the Biden administration’s more distant posture. MBS needed the US technology access that AI Diffusion controlled; Trump needed foreign investment pledges and geopolitical wins ahead of domestic political timelines. The AI deal was the most technically specific and immediately actionable element of that mutual need — and both sides understood it.

At the geopolitical level, the Major Non-NATO Ally designation was not symbolic. It provided a formal defense cooperation framework that underpins the AI Diffusion licensing pathway: the US government’s determination that Saudi Arabia is a Major Non-NATO Ally is, in effect, a political certification of sufficient trust to receive advanced AI hardware at scale. This certification required MBS’s sustained diplomatic groundwork — the restoration of US-Saudi relationships over the preceding two years — and the summit’s political context to achieve. Without MBS’s diplomatic management of that relationship, the NVIDIA deal would have faced licensing obstacles that could have delayed the buildout by years.

The Staging: Jensen Huang in Riyadh

The presence of NVIDIA CEO Jensen Huang at the Trump-MBS summit, physically in the room with two heads of state, was a deliberate staging choice that communicated multiple messages simultaneously. It told global technology companies that Saudi Arabia was negotiating at the geopolitical table, not just the procurement table. It told the US government that NVIDIA — a company of significant domestic political importance given its role in US AI competitiveness — endorsed the Saudi deal. It told Humain’s future commercial partners that the most important silicon vendor in the world was committed to the Saudi AI buildout.

Huang’s “AI like electricity and the internet is essential infrastructure for every nation” statement in Riyadh was not spontaneous — it is a formulation consistent with NVIDIA’s global messaging that MBS’s team had almost certainly coordinated in advance. The framing served Saudi Arabia’s interests directly: it positioned the AI buildout as essential national infrastructure rather than commercial speculation, lending it the inevitability narrative that accompanies investments in power grids and internet backbone.

SDAIA Chairmanship: Governance by Crown Prince Directive

MBS’s role as Chair of SDAIA has direct practical implications for how AI policy is made and enforced in Saudi Arabia. When SDAIA issues its Generative AI Guidelines, AI Ethics Principles, or PDPL implementing regulations, these documents carry the political weight of Crown Prince backing rather than merely ministerial authority. International companies navigating Saudi AI regulation are not engaging with a conventional technocratic regulator; they are engaging with the institutional expression of MBS’s technology vision.

This backing creates a regulatory environment that is, on balance, more favorable to international AI investment than most developed country alternatives. SDAIA’s permissive-but-supervised approach — which differs substantially from the EU AI Act’s prescriptive framework and China’s increasingly strict AI content and recommendation regulations — reflects MBS’s stated goal of making Saudi Arabia attractive for AI investment. Regulatory approaches that would deter the international partnerships that the buildout requires are politically constrained, not because SDAIA lacks authority to impose them but because MBS’s strategic interests run in the opposite direction.

The regulatory posture will not remain static. As the AI buildout matures and Saudi Arabia develops more domestic AI capabilities, the calculation of where Saudi interests lie in AI governance will evolve. The current permissive stance reflects the priority of attracting investment; a future stance may reflect the priority of protecting Saudi AI industries from external competition. MBS will make that call when the time comes.

NEOM: The Urban AI Laboratory

NEOM — the $500 billion futuristic city project on Saudi Arabia’s Red Sea coast — is the most direct physical expression of MBS’s technology vision translated into built environment at urban scale. Tonomus, NEOM’s technology subsidiary, is effectively his laboratory for proving that AI-governed cities are technically buildable and commercially viable.

THE LINE, the flagship NEOM linear city concept, was originally envisioned at 170 kilometers of linear urban fabric serving 9 million residents by 2030 — an AI-managed environment with no surface vehicles, all mobility underground or pedestrian, all services AI-coordinated. The concept has faced scope reductions and timeline extensions: the initial phase is now expected to house tens of thousands rather than millions of residents. But the underlying ambition — a city designed from the ground up for AI governance — remains the reference case for how MBS thinks about the intersection of AI and urban life at scale.

The Tonomus AI deployments being developed for NEOM — intelligent mobility systems, AI-managed energy infrastructure, smart healthcare delivery, digital identity and services — will generate a dataset of AI-governed urban operations that is globally unique if deployed at meaningful scale. If NEOM’s urban AI systems work, they become exportable intellectual property: Saudi Arabia as a global provider of AI-governed city management systems. If they struggle, NEOM becomes the most expensive cautionary tale in the history of smart city ambition.

Political Risk: Single Point of Failure

The concentration of the entire Saudi AI buildout in MBS’s personal strategic vision creates a single-point-of-failure governance risk that is genuine and underappreciated in most analyses of the buildout’s prospects.

MBS has consolidated Saudi political authority more completely than any ruler since the founding generation. The 2017 Ritz Carlton episode — in which hundreds of Saudi businessmen and princes were detained — dramatically reduced the organized internal political opposition that could challenge his direction. The 2018 execution of his cousin Mohammed bin Nayef in detention, as reported by intelligence assessments, removed the alternative succession line. His handling of the Khashoggi fallout — surviving the international reputational damage through patient diplomatic rehabilitation — demonstrated resilience to external pressure that skeptics had underestimated.

Nevertheless, the risks are real and irreducible. MBS is one person with finite attention competing across multiple priority domains. The AI buildout competes for his attention with NEOM’s construction challenges, Aramco’s strategic decisions, regional security dynamics (Yemen, Iran, Israel), domestic social policy, and the management of a 35-million-person state. Sustained personal engagement across a five-to-ten-year AI buildout timeline is not guaranteed by institutional design; it depends on his continued personal conviction that AI is Vision 2030’s highest-priority sector.

Health risk, however low probability, deserves acknowledgment as a structural consideration rather than a political statement. The Saudi succession process in the event of MBS’s incapacitation is not defined with the institutional clarity that democratic succession processes provide. International investors and technology companies building decade-long strategies around the Saudi AI buildout are making an implicit bet on political continuity that no governance structure fully protects.

Saudi vs. UAE: MBS vs. MBZ

The implicit competition between Saudi Arabia and the UAE for leadership of Gulf AI investment runs through the entire Saudi buildout narrative. Mohammed bin Zayed (MBZ), the UAE’s ruler, built the UAE’s AI strategy through G42, Mubadala’s technology portfolio, and the Technology Innovation Institute with earlier international engagement than Saudi Arabia achieved. The UAE’s G42 partnership with Microsoft — a $1.5 billion deal in 2024 that brought Emirati AI into the US technology ecosystem — preceded Humain’s launch by a year and established a template that Saudi Arabia has since replicated at larger scale.

MBS’s May 2025 Humain launch was, in part, a deliberate move to establish Saudi Arabia’s primacy in Gulf AI unambiguously, using scale as the differentiating factor. The $77 billion commitment — versus the UAE’s more diffuse AI investment portfolio — was calibrated to be unmistakably larger and more concentrated. The Arabic AI framing (Allam, Humain Chat, Arabic-first positioning) stakes a national identity claim that the UAE, with its more cosmopolitan and English-dominant technology ecosystem, cannot fully contest on the same terms.

The competition matters for global technology companies choosing Gulf partners. Saudi Arabia offers larger capital commitments, a larger domestic market, and more direct government backing than any other Gulf state. The UAE offers more operational maturity, a more internationally familiar business environment, and an earlier-mover advantage in AI ecosystem development. MBS’s bet is that scale and national identity create more durable competitive advantages than head start and operational sophistication. Whether that bet is right will define the Gulf AI competitive landscape for the next decade.

What to Watch

The most important leading indicators for MBS’s continued personal engagement with the AI buildout: his direct participation in major AI milestones (summit appearances, product launches, institutional announcements); the pace of PIF capital deployment into Humain versus other Vision 2030 priorities, which reflects where his attention is directing resources; the organizational continuity of key AI-sector figures — rapid leadership turnover at SDAIA, Humain, or PIF AI divisions can indicate shifting political winds; and Saudi Arabia’s engagement in international AI governance forums as a proxy for sustained strategic interest in global AI positioning rather than domestic infrastructure alone.

The most consequential test of MBS’s commitment will come during execution difficulties — construction delays, technology setbacks, commercial revenue shortfalls, or an external crisis that diverts attention. How the Saudi AI system responds to those challenges will reveal whether the buildout has institutional depth independent of its patron, or whether it remains primarily a personal vision that requires his active sponsorship at every stage.
